Restrictions on discharging firearms near livestock corrals modified.
This bill modifies Minnesota's existing law restricting firearm discharge near livestock corrals. It clarifies that the 500-foot rule does not apply to hunters during established seasons on state or local government land (excluding road rights-of-way) or to landowners shooting on their own property or land owned by an immediate family member. The change specifically exempts normal hunting activities and personal land use from the restriction. This directly affects livestock owners, hunters, and landowners by adjusting when firearm use near corrals is permitted.
